I have a situation which I don't really know how to handle.
The graph shows the points for every month of the year(s), everything fine until this point.
Now, I want to actually calculate the average on previous x months and show it into the current month (Like: avg (current month)+avg(previous month)...Kind of multi-month average.
Unfortunately until now, there is no possibility for me to do it. I'm thinking that maybe preparing a table when loading the data with some informations would help. Did someone have the same problem and managed to solve it until now?

As dimension:
Month
As a measure: try sthing like:
Aggr(
RangeAvg(Above(
Avg(Measure)
,0,1))
,Month)

Anyhow, I have an additional question:
I have implemented the following formula and as far as I can see, there are the same results for both of them, can you maybe let me know what is the difference?
My formula:
RangeAvg(Above(
Avg(Measure)
,0,1))
What this does, it calculate the avg of the actual point of dimension and the one just above it (the previous month)
Now, if u change the sorting of ur chart, the previous Month could be not really the previous one but maybe the next month?
Which will lead to a miscalculation
Thus, when adding the aggregation by Month, u tell Qlik to always consider ur chart to be sorted by Month asc.
So, even if the sorting changes, Qlik'll always consider the above (Month) as the previous one (the real previous one)
